Researchers reveal blood clot risk and anticoagulation benefits in discharged COVID-19 patients Apr 9 2021 In the largest study of its kind, Feinstein Institutes for Medical Research and Northwell COVID-19 Research Consortium researchers reveal blood clot risk and anticoagulation benefits in hospitalized co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) patients who have been recently discharged from the hospital. The report, recently published in the journal Blood, finds that prophylactic anticoagulants reduce the risk of major thromboembolic events and death by 46 percent. Alex C.
